Director of Artificial Intelligence (AI) & Emerging Technologies (SY26-27)
Boston Public Schools
Boston, MA · $126,976 · Education, Education (K-12), Innovation & Tech
The Director of AI & Emerging Technology will lead the strategy, governance, and implementation of artificial intelligence across Boston Public Schools. This role is responsible for identifying high-impact opportunities for AI, driving pilot initiatives, and scaling solutions that support teaching, learning, and district operations while ensuring responsible use and data protection.
Key Responsibilities:
- Define and lead district-wide strategy for AI adoption across instruction and operations.
- Design and oversee pilot initiatives using a "pilot → evaluate → scale" model.
- Establish policies for responsible AI use, including student data privacy and ethical standards.
- Lead evaluation and selection of AI tools and vendors.
- Establish and lead a cross-functional AI Center of Excellence.
- Develop staff AI literacy training and communication resources.
Requirements:
- Bachelor's degree in education, technology, public administration, or related field.
- 5-7+ years of experience leading innovation, cross-functional initiatives, or technology transformations.
- Foundational understanding of AI/ML concepts (LLMs, generative AI).
- Experience with enterprise technology environments, data governance, and privacy regulations.
- Strong leadership, communication, and change management skills.
- Authorization to work in the United States and residency requirements (Managerial position).
